20.

一只虫子从立方体的一个顶点出发,并按如下规则沿立方体的棱移动。在每个顶点,这只虫子会从该顶点发出的三条棱中选择一条前进。每条棱被选中的概率相等,且所有选择相互独立。七次移动后,这只虫子恰好访问每个顶点一次的概率是多少?

A bug starts at one vertex of a cube and moves along the edges of the cube according to the following rule. At each vertex the bug will choose to travel along one of the three edges emanating from that vertex. Each edge has equal probability of being chosen, and all choices are independent. What is the probability that after seven moves the bug will have visited every vertex exactly once?

12187\dfrac{1}{2187}

1729\dfrac{1}{729}

2243\dfrac{2}{243}

181\dfrac{1}{81}

5243\dfrac{5}{243}

答案:C
知识点:基本概率图论分类讨论
难度评级:2070
解答:

从起点出发共有 373^7 条等可能的 77-步路径。考虑一条访问全部 88 个顶点的路径:第一步有 33 种选择,第二步有 22 种选择。

将前三个顶点标为 000,001,011000,001,011, 虫子下一步必须走到两个顶点之一;在每种情况下,剩余移动都被确定。这给出 323=183 \cdot 2 \cdot 3 = 18 条这样的路径。 010,110,111,101,100,010,110,100,101,111,111,101,100,110,010. \begin{aligned} &010,110,111,101,100,\\ &010,110,100,101,111,\\ &111,101,100,110,010. \end{aligned}

概率为 1837=182187=2243\dfrac{18}{3^7} = \dfrac{18}{2187} = \dfrac{2}{243}

因此,正确答案是 C

From the start there are 373^7 equally likely 77-move walks. For a walk visiting all 88 vertices, there are 33 choices for the first move and 22 for the second, since it cannot return to the starting vertex.

Label cube vertices by three-bit strings. By symmetry, after fixing those first two moves we may take the first three vertices to be 000,001,011.000,001,011. A branch check gives exactly these three completions: 010,110,111,101,100,010,110,100,101,111,111,101,100,110,010. \begin{aligned} &010,110,111,101,100,\\ &010,110,100,101,111,\\ &111,101,100,110,010. \end{aligned} Thus there are 323=183 \cdot 2 \cdot 3 = 18 such walks.

The probability is 1837=182187=2243.\dfrac{18}{3^7} = \dfrac{18}{2187} = \dfrac{2}{243}.

Thus, the correct answer is C.
